What about Solterra?  We're nestled on twenty acres of woodlands and open
fields; there are forty homesites, each with direct car access.  All the
homes are  free standing with the exception of two sets of duplexes. 
They are architect or designer planned to suit  individual tastes, but
must meet Architectural Review Board and covenant requirements.  Each
home accesses one of three pathways, all leading to the common areas.  No
need to cross a road!

We offer all the best aspects of co-housing.  There are ample play spaces
for our children, including an adult friendly tree house.  That means
accessible!  Our organic gardens were a great success this year, with
crops of flowers and vegetables.  A group effort succeeded in erecting an
effective deer fence.  It's still a happiness, however, to look out the
window at the adjoining woods, and see the mother deer and her three
babies paying a morning visit.  There's a tree swing, a huge sand box, a
sliding pole.

Our common house is in the planning stage.  We hold parties in our Little
Common House, a large shed that was part of the original farmstead.  We
eat together each week  at potlucks in the shed or at each others' homes,
or out in the meadow.  We cater to a variety of eating styles from
macrobiotic, vegan, and vegetarian, to meat preferences.

Solterrans range in age from not-quite-here to over seventy, and people
come from all over the country.  We're care givers, teachers, business
people, health care professionals, artists, musicians, and writers.  We
work by consensus.  We play by heart.

There are currently fourteen families in residence, and our non resident
members are active participants in the community.  By year's end, there
will be twenty families living here.
